Specifications
EPCOS (TDK) B65881AR97 technical specifications, attributes, parameters and parts with similar specifications to EPCOS (TDK) B65881AR97.
  • Width:
    26.00mm
  • Tolerance:
    -20%, 30%
  • Supplier Device Package:
    PQ 35 x 35
  • Series:
    B65881A
  • Minimum Core Cross Section (Amin) mm²:
    146.5
  • Material:
    N97
  • Length:
    35.10mm
  • Initial Permeability (µi):
    2300
  • Inductance Factor (Al):
    4.7µH
  • Height:
    17.40mm
  • Gap:
    Ungapped
  • Finish:
    Uncoated
  • Effective Permeability (µe):
    1750
  • Effective Magnetic Volume (Ve) mm³:
    13440
  • Effective Length (le) mm:
    79.2
  • Effective Area (Ae) mm²:
    169.7
  • Diameter:
    -
  • Core Type:
    PQ
  • Core Factor (ΣI/A) mm-1:
    0.467
